On January 21, 2026, after a very brief and unexpected illness, Shot LeSueur entered the gates

of Heaven with his family surrounding his bedside.

Daniel Edward LeSueur (better known as Shot) was born November 4, 1940, along with his

twin sister Dainy. They were born at their Buckingham home to parents John Daniel and Beulah

Thomas LeSueur. In addition to Dainy, there was one other sibling, Alvin. Shot was preceded in

death by his parents and siblings.

After 63 years of marriage, Betty Jo Ownby LeSueur will cherish many memories of Shot.

Together in their Christian home, Shot and Betty Jo raised two sons Danny (Becky) and Johnny

(Kristi). But the pride of Shot's world was his grandchildren: Danielle (Scott), Emily (Anthony),

Claire, Daniel, Aiden, Jenna, and Wyatt. His sweet great-granddaughter, Willow Faye, brought

the biggest smiles.

Also surviving Shot are his special sisters-in-law, Gladys, Dotty, Frankie, Patsy; the mother

of three of his granddaughters, Kim. His sister-in-law Linda preceded him in death.

Shot was a faithful, kindhearted, and man of God. His love for Hatcher Baptist Church

shone through with each grass cutting or with everything he fixed. Shot loved working outdoors,

producing a yearly garden that could feed an army. His love for automobiles led him to a career

as an auto body man at Moon's Body Shop. Later in life he still worked on autos at home.

All services will be held at Hatcher Baptist Church on Saturday January 24, 2026.

Family Visitation will be from 10 to 11 a.m., with a celebration of life beginning at 11 a.m.

Due to the impending winter storm, the family requests that in lieu of flowers donations in Shot's

memory be made to the Hatcher Baptist Church Missions Fund. This fund is used to support

various missionaries sponsored by the church members and all donations go directly to the missionary families.
